Transaction ecc3decf2b21f625a79da4fd487ec381eda964df638872a635ca8f9e7cd7684a
1 Input
1 Output
-
ecc3decf2b21f625a79da4fd487ec381eda964df638872a635ca8f9e7cd7684a:0
- value
- 8854204
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f63465a7bd3717b0970cab17eb0efbc15ac12ae
- address
- bc1qfa35vknm6dchkztse2chav80hs26cy4wl2fw0c